A batch of masks from Huzhou to Shanghai for proprietors


In the morning of the day before New Year’s Eve, director Zhang Gong of Shanghai Park One property management service drove away from Shanghai to his native place Huzhou. Before leaving, he bade all property management divisions to maintain strict epidemic prevention and control. He was not leaving for a vacation but a tough and urgent mission of purchasing a batch of masks for proprietors.


Masks are scarce for the moment. Although the property management service itself was very short of it, director Zhang has been thinking about preparing masks for proprietors and ensuring the personal protection of proprietors regardless of his own difficulties. Masks are the most important shield protecting individuals from the epidemic, and director Zhang’s behavior reflects the foresight of Binjiang Property’s frontline property management personnel with the development of the epidemic.


“It’s just too difficult to buy masks in Shanghai. So I went back to Huzhou and thought maybe I can find some at pharmacies there.” With such hope, director Zhang set out on his journey.


On the next day that was the New Year’s Eve, director Zhang appeared in the community of Shanghai Park One in the morning. Though exhausted from the long travel, he immediately arranged property management staff to distribute the 1000 masks he acquired by all means from pharmacies in Huzhou to proprietors who had been waiting very anxiously. Almost two hundred proprietors finally received such masks, which were more precious than any other items the moment.

As the mask supply fell so short of demand and couldn’t satisfy more people, director Zhang thought over and hurriedly went back to Huzhou on the first day of the New Year. Fortunately, he was able to purchase and bring back several hundred of masks again for proprietors.

On January 21st, Binjiang Property initiated comprehensive epidemic prevention and control of Shanghai Park One, including disinfecting public areas frequently, taking body temperature of proprietors coming in and out, registering personnel information, and so on. And early on January 25th, Shanghai Park One was one of the first few that implemented closed-off management and carried out strict prevention and control measures such as keeping all couriers and takeout deliverymen out and requiring proprietors to enter and leave with a permit.
